Tbh I’ve never really gone overboard on the first clean I just look at what it’s gonna be worth to me long term,why lose it on the first clean when it might be worth 1500-2000 a year to you I’ve got many like that I do that needed a first clean and took a bit more time but long term are brilliant earners.
You can smell and time waster when you’ve been in this job for a while,I can’t see the point in ever charging double unless it’s a concrete sellotape or cement job,if it’s just a case that they haven’t had a window cleaner for years the old hot water gets em back clean.
